June Jennings’s Biography

I currently serve as the engagement and partnerships manager for Field of Vision, the award-winning, filmmaker-driven documentary unit that has produced three Academy Award nominees for Best Documentary Short Subject.

I also host The Doc Exchange: A Real Stories Podcast, where I interview celebrated documentary filmmakers about the films that have changed their lives and influenced their work. The Doc Exchange is available on Spotify, Apple Podcasts, and Google Podcasts.

Previously, I worked as an assistant editor at O, The Oprah Magazine (now Oprah Daily). I’ve written about pop culture, politics, and wellness for O, The Nation, Colorlines, Supermajority, and Paste, and my writing on affirmative action was featured in the New York Times.
